Abstract

A survey was conducted to ascertain the current situation of early-mid-career pediatric cardiologists (<20 years of experience) practicing in India. A formatted questionnaire was sent as a Google Form through email and WhatsApp link. Out of 275 eligible participants, 138 responses were received. Two pediatric cardiologists independently analyzed the data and responses are presented. Results showed pediatric cardiology is not considered a lucrative career option by most of the surveyed Indian pediatric cardiologists. Urgent remedial measures are needed to maintain the recently found momentum in the field in the country.
